Across TCGA patient cohorts, ZNF451 protein abundance is significantly associated with the RNA expression of many other genes, with 11,525 significant associations in total. LSCC shows the largest number of these associations.
The most reproducible ZNF451-associated genes across cancer lineages are MCM3, SAYSD1, and ZBTB24. Each is linked with ZNF451 in more than 5 cancer types. Because this analysis shows association rather than direction, both ZNF451-to-partner and partner-to-ZNF451 results are reported.
Each partner links to its own Q-omics profile. The scatter plot shows the strongest example, ZNF451 versus MCM3 in LSCC, with a Pearson correlation of 0.64.
